My name is Jax, and I'm the owner and lead developer of Bulbrook Web Designs. I started programming because I loved building things that solved real problems. Eventually I realized I could combine that passion with helping small businesses establish a professional online presence.

After working with local businesses, I noticed a common pattern. Many couldn't justify spending thousands of dollars upfront on a website, while others had paid a premium for sites that looked outdated or generated few leads. That's why I built a pricing model that makes professional websites affordable without sacrificing quality.

Every website I build is designed with speed, SEO, accessibility, and conversions in mind. My goal isn't just to make something that looks nice—it's to create a website that helps your business grow for years to come.

How long does the subscription last?

The subscription plan lasts for a minimum of 12 months and then continues month-to-month. After the first year you may cancel at any time.

What happens if I cancel after 12 months?

Your website will be taken offline, but you can always restart service later.

What happens if I cancel before 12 months?

If you cancel before the 12 months, you owe the full cost of what the site would normally cost as a lump sum minus whatever you already paid. We prioritize long term relationships with our clients, and we want clients to share the same philosophy.

How do you handle late payments?

We send several reminders leading up to and following the date of payment, before eventually moving on to more extreme methods. We are generally very flexible and can offer assistance if need be, but if there is no communication we may be forced to shut down services temporarily.

What payment methods do you accept?

We send email invoices via Square that has a link to a secure page for adding payment info. Subscriptions are paid with a credit card or debit card and we accept all major credit cards. Lump sum projects are paid with ACH bank transfer to minimize processing fees. WE DO NOT ACCEPT CHECKS OR MONEY ORDERS.

$100 per additional page—is that one time?

Yes. Additional pages are a one-time development fee.

Are there refunds?

When you sign a contract, either lump sum or subscription, if we cannot design something you are 100% happy with and no longer want to move forward, then we will refund whatever you paid to get started. If we do end up moving forward with building the site, there are no refunds after that point. From then on, refunds are at our discretion.
